Aisha Falode hails Bayelsa Queens on Champions League ticket
Aisha Falode, the chairperson of the Nigeria Women Football League (NWFL), has congratulated Yenagoa's Bayelsa Queens Football Club for winning the 2022 WAFU B Zonal Qualifiers and earning a spot in the CAF Women's Champions League.

Falode praised the current NWFL Champions for their perseverance, fortitude, and winning mentality throughout their campaign at the WAFU B Zonal qualifiers, and she added that she had firsthand experience of the Nigerian champions' winning mentality while she was travelling with the team to Yamoussoukro.

She said: “I was not surprised when I got the news that they emerged champions of the WAFU B Zonal Qualifiers.

“The team was well motivated to achieve their new status by the Bayelsa state government represented in Cote d’Ivoire by the state Commissioner for Youth and Sports, Honourable Daniel Igali.

“The team was determined to win the WAFU B Zonal title to qualify for the CAF Women Champions League right from their first game played in Yamoussoukro.

“They had their target and beating their finals’ opponent from Ghana, Ampem Darkoa Ladies, 3-0, was not a surprise especially seeing all the three goals of the final game, scored in the first half by Miracle Joseph, Flourish Sabastine and Chinyere Igbomalu.”

The NFF Executive Committee member urged Bayelsa Queens FC players and officials not to relent in their efforts to move a step further to win the CAF Women’s Champions League title in Morocco, later in the year, adding their success will lift Nigeria’s profile as the true number one women football playing country in Africa.
